Holiday in Crete 'is everything the brochures show and more'
Tourists flicking through the latest glossy magazines and brochures who find themselves tempted by a holiday in Crete have been told the reality is even more spectacular than any publication can show.
A writer for the Sheffield Telegraph recalls her experiences on the Mediterranean island, claiming they were better than she could have imagined.
The author explains the weather repeatedly hit 100 degrees Fahrenheit, making for a warm and enjoyable break.
Among the highlights of spending time in this part of the world is a visit to the Knossos site, which is described as one of the "key archaeological centres" of the planet.
There were also plenty of shops and restaurants on hand for those who love to indulge in a little retail therapy, or simply munch on a traditional and tasty meal.
Christine Marlow recently wrote a letter to the Daily Telegraph nominating a holiday in Crete as her favourite travel option of all.
